Who we are
At Traction Rec, community is at the heart of everything we do. We empower nonprofit organizations like YMCAs, Jewish Community Centers (JCCs), and Boys & Girls Clubs of America (BGCA) to strengthen their communities through great technology built on the Salesforce platform. By enabling these organizations to deliver their services more efficiently, we help them focus on creating meaningful connections and driving positive change where it matters most.

What You Will Be Doing
- Work with the product team to validate requirements and product solutions, finding gaps that others have missed, and to identify areas of high impact if automated testing were introduced
- Define test scenarios with the development team
- Work alongside development daily to provide quality insights, direct testing, and keep on top of incoming changes
- Manual QA on new features to begin planning your test suites
- Helping the wider team in determining standards and processes
- Create documentation of application changes, configuration, or known issues
Compensation
At Traction Rec, we are committed to a fair, market-based and equitable compensation structure. Our market data is refreshed on an annual basis to reflect the most current market conditions.
The starting salary band for this role is $70,000-$85,000. Starting salaries will vary within this range based on experience, skill level, and internal equity related to the role.
Please note that the range details above reflect the base pay only and does not include our competitive bonus program and benefits that we offer.
